It’s been quite a journey since my co-English lead and I attended a session back in January or February last year, to find out a little bit about Lexia as a program. Within ten minutes of that demonstration starting, I was hooked. Amongst other positives, I knew it would be great for engaging our reluctant readers.

We have now made another purchase with you based on the success of the program within my Year 6 class during last year’s lockdown from March onwards, and have been able to roll out the program to all of our Year 2, 4, 5 and 6 children. Feedback from staff has been really positive – you can imagine how teaching staff generally respond when a subject lead cheerfully announces, “And here’s something new that I’d really like you to fit in your timetables for your class every week!”.

I have presented to Governors about the success of the program, both Lexia and PowerUp (which we now have had six children progress onto). Key reasons to support our recent additional purchase were:

  • Engagement of reluctant readers, and additionally those at high level.
  • A way of overcoming that age-old hurdle in our area of children (not) reading at home.
  • The facility for class teachers to monitor usage, progress and areas of individual difficulty with ease and at speed.
  • The fact that the program can be easily installed and used at home, which was of huge benefit during the spring/summer lockdown, and potentially for another lockdown.
  • The pre-set ‘lessons’ for those who are flagged as struggling with a concept.
  • Production of professional-looking certificates on completion of a level.
  • An educational tool which our parents also feel is beneficial!

The whole Lexia experience has been hugely positive: for the children, the staff and myself as Senior Teacher and co-English Lead.
